Output 96f521ae17c325f4ca783c0327b4c5a15ed178337cbe1fa8dc02fca012d571cb:1

value
29019593
script pubkey
OP_0 OP_PUSHBYTES_20 1d3baeb58b7926e477bca36ce3b03ff4a38ed559
address
bc1qr5a6advt0ynwgaau5dkw8vpl7j3ca42eg2a3z6
transaction
96f521ae17c325f4ca783c0327b4c5a15ed178337cbe1fa8dc02fca012d571cb
spent
true